Frequently asked questions

What is the name of Leaz's airport?
Leaz is served by several airports, but most visitors choose to touch down at Cointrin Intl. Airport (GVA).
How far is Cointrin Intl. Airport (GVA) from central Leaz?
Cointrin Airport is 23 kilometres from central Leaz, so be prepared for a reasonable commute into the heart of the city.
What airport is best to fly into Leaz?
Step off the plane at GVA and you'll find yourself 23 kilometres from the centre of town. Chambery - Savoie Airport (CMF) also welcomes many travellers to Leaz. It sits 56 kilometres from the city centre.

Do you have any tips for my flight to Leaz?
We've pulled together all the info you need to make your journey as stress-free as possible. Follow our tips and tricks and you'll be cruising through the airport and exploring Leaz in next to no time. What to pack in your hand luggage:

  • The trick to having a great travel experience is to pack in advance. First up, the essentials: passport, travel docs, credit cards and medications. Next, bring on board items that'll help keep you occupied, like some electronic gadgets or a good read. It's also wise to pack your chargers, a neck pillow and a pair of noise-cancelling headphones. And of course, don't forget to toss in toiletry items like a toothbrush, cleansing wipes and a clean T-shirt.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Check carefully that you don't have a Swiss Army knife hiding in your hand luggage. Other prohibited items include flammable or explosive products, such as aerosol cans and bleach, and liquids and gels in containers lar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res).

What to wear on a flight:

  • Choose comfort over style. Prepare for temperature changes by donning layers, and pick easy-to-remove footwear like sneakers.
  • Deep vein thrombosis (DVT) can pose a risk on long-distance flights. It results from blood clots forming due to inactivity and poor circulation, so do some gentle foot and leg exercises in your seat and consider wearing compression socks or tights.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Leaz?
Being organised before you get to the airport will make your getaway to Leaz a piece of cake. We've compiled some handy hints for a stress-free journey through security:

  • Be sure to have your travel documents and passport within close reach. They're the first items you'll be asked for by security.
  • Next up, both you and your hand luggage must be X-rayed. To make the process quick and painless, take off anything that is likely to trigger the alarm. Items like your coat, belt and headphones need to go through the machine.
  • Electronic devices like phones and laptops will also have to go on a tray to be scanned. Don't worry though, you'll be back online before you know it.
  • Any gels or liquids, such as shampoo or hairspray, that you want to take on board must be no greater than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res). Also, everything must fit inside a quart-size (one litre), clear zip-close bag.
  • Lightweight sneakers are a clever footwear choice as you're less likely to be required to remove them when passing through security. Big boots and other heavy-style shoes are usually subjected to extra screening.
  • Sharp or pointed items are prohibited in the cabin. They'll be confiscated at security, so pack them safely away in your checked luggage.
